Optimum energy savings through good measuring techniques

September 2000 Flow Measurement & Control

Frankfurt Main airport in Germany recently discovered that with various Danfoss electromagnetic flowmeters used together with its established measuring techniques, the airport was able to lower energy consumption, resulting in less environmental strain. Maintenance free flowmeters from Danfoss were installed in the main pipes of the heat and cool air supply systems. Fifteen ultrasonic heat meters of type SONO 3000 with PTB approval were installed in the hot water pipes featuring an accuracy of 0,5% of the measuring value. Forty electromagnetic flowmeters of type MAG 3000 PT and MAG 2500 were installed in the cooling pipes featuring an accuracy of 0,25% of the measuring value.

Often saving possibilities are not used because it is very difficult to specify the actual value of such savings. Therefore, one of the main objectives when implementing this new monitoring system was to ensure that it was capable of reading all technical data such as output, temperature, pressure, outdoor temperature, relative air humidity and volume flow. Furthermore, the system should provide features such as system transparency, user friendliness, data safety and energy control. Finally, there was a request for documentation of operational conditions such as meter failures and documentation of alarms.

The airport initially approached Danfoss as a result of its reputation for offering units that are user-friendly, accurate, stable and reliable. These vital features combined with technical back-up from the Danfoss flow experts fully satisfied their expectations. The monitoring system was mounted in Terminal 2 and, shortly after, the department in charge of the operation was able to report considerable energy savings.
